Description
Join Mr. Langlois, upper school astronomy teacher, for an evening of star-gazing and astronomy instruction. On a mutually agreeable date, from dusk until the cows come home, Mr. Langlois will host up to 6 people to view some of the sky's summer highlights. There will be multiple telescopes and electronically assisted viewing (video cameras) available with automatic GOTO and manual tracking. All other necessary equipment will be supplied, as will snacks and hot or cold drinks as the evening demands.
